PROCEDURE
实验过程
A 25-mL round bottom flask containing a magnetic stir bar and fitted with an inert gas inlet was charged with ethyl 1-(4-chloro-3-methoxyphenyl)piperidine-4-carboxylate, hydrochloride salt (367 mg, 1.23 mmol), AcOH (6 mL) and water (3.0 mL). The mixture was treated with N-chlorosuccinimide (206 mg, 1.54 mmol) in one portion. The mixture was stirred under argon at RT overnight and then diluted with water (20 mL) and Et2O (60 mL). The pH of the mixture was adjusted to a pH=10. The phases were separated and the aqueous phase was extracted with Et2O. The combined Et2O extracts were washed with brine, dried (MgSO4) and concentrated on a rotary evaporator. The resultant residue was purified by flash chromatography using a 12 g silica gel cartridge and gradient elution from 50:1 Hex/EtOAc to 20:1 Hex/EtOAc to elute the product. The fractions containing the product were pooled and concentrated on a rotary evaporator to give ethyl 1-(2,4-dichloro-5-methoxyphenyl)piperidine-4-carboxylate (255 mg, 0.77 mmol, 70% yield) as a clear oil, which solidified on standing at room temperature. 1H-NMR (400 MHz, CDCl3) δ ppm 7.33 (1 H, s), 6.58 (1 H, s), 4.15 (2 H, qd, J=7.04, 6.87 Hz), 3.87 (3 H, s), 3.33 (2 H, d, J=11.70 Hz), 2.70 (2 H, t, J=9.66 Hz), 2.43 (1 H, dq, J=10.17, 5.09 Hz), 1.94-2.05 (4 H, m), 1.22-1.30 (3 H, m).
